Originally, the Spectator was known as the Hamilton Courier as established in 1859 by Thomas Wotton Sheville, it then became the Hamilton Spectator and Grange District Advertiser in 1860, and later The Hamilton Spectator. The newspaper is published Tuesday, Thursday and Saturday.
